Lakeside Luxury: Elegant Wedding Inspiration at The Commodore in Hartland, WI

Inspired by coastal tones and refined simplicity, this Lakeside Luxury styled shoot at The Commodore in Hartland, Wisconsin, explores a fresh, modern approach to vintage wedding design through a black tie palette, layered with light blue details and ample greenery for a hint of color.

Set against the backdrop of a historic lakeside venue, each scene and detail came together to create a clean, design-driven aesthetic rooted in the beauty of its surroundings.

This clean, fresh wedding inspiration at The Commodore was coordinated, designed, and photographed by Makayla Mashlan Photography. Located in Hartland, Wisconsin, near Milwaukee, The Commodore is a premier lakeside wedding venue and restaurant with multiple spaces for preparation and gathering. Spaces showcased during this styled shoot included the Nagawicka Suite for bridal preparation, the Boat Room for groom preparation, the Baldwin Lounge, Pleasant View Pavilion for the ceremony, and the Grand Heritage Ballroom for the reception.

The venue dates back to 1902, offering beautifully renovated spaces, delicious menu offerings, and views of the Nagawicka Lake.

Adeline Margaret designed stationery and signage pieces for the day, beginning with a luxurious, torn-edge, vintage-inspired invitation. The pieces, ranging from neutral taupes to soft dusty blues and greys, also included a details card, printed envelopes, menus, welcome sign, name cards, and table numbers. Designs paired a calligraphic script font with text type, playing with ample negative space and intricate floral illustrations and patterns. A contour-cut tulip silhouette added a final modern touch.

Melissa Ann Artistry + Co. styled hair and makeup for The Rock Agency model, Dante. Her hair was parted slightly to the side and curled into loose, effortlessly beautiful waves. Makeup was natural and glowing, accentuating her eyes with champagne eyeshadow and long lashes. A soft rouge finish on the cheeks and a natural lip completed the editorial-worthy, subtle glam.

Bucci’s Bridal selected two distinct strapless gowns to transition from the ceremony to the reception. The first dress was an artful, modern take on the resurgence of the basque waist ballgown. Instead of a traditional basque waist, where the fabric meets in a “v” or a “u” at the center of the waist, this dress featured a sheath front, with dramatically ruched hips flaring into a full skirt. The dress was simple and elegant, made from luxe satin fabric, and paired with an elbow-length tulle veil.

Kesslers Diamonds provided shimmering drop earrings and a collection of diamond rings set against yellow gold.

Model Aiden wore a tasteful three-piece black suit from DuBois Formalwear, which also blended vintage and modern elements. Satin on the suit jacket collar added a touch of texture and movement, and he was also fitted with a white undershirt and accessorized with a black bow tie, floral boutonniere, and white pocket square. At the reception, he switched into a white suit jacket for a slightly more casual, carefree look.

The ceremony scene was set on The Commodore’s outdoor pavilion, surrounded by beautiful natural landscapes and lake views. Canopies Events provided the white ceremony chairs, which led down the aisle to a grounded floral arch, bookended by wooden pedestals topped with floral arrangements.

Florals for the day by Events by Vanessa combined a natural wildflower aesthetic with fresh and unexpected arrangements, like a cradle bridal bouquet of tulips, lilies, and green amaranthus. The flowers, which also included hydrangeas and white and blue delphiniums, were set against lush fern greenery and other elements, such as green grapes.

Several vendors contributed to the atmosphere at the reception, set in the The Commodore’s Grand Heritage Ballroom, one of the venue’s signature event spaces overlooking Nagawicka Lake. Tablescapes Event Rentals brought white table lamps, adding to the warmth of the sun streaming in the wall-to-wall windows and light from the chandeliers above. BBJ La Tavola provided pale blue linens, secured with pearl napkin holders.

Other important reception pieces included textured satin tablecloths, crystal glassware, mismatched scalloped and patterned plating, and towering floral centerpieces.

Mili Wonka Treats took a twist on tradition at the dessert table, with a rectangular, one-tier wedding cake with ornate piped frosting. Set atop a round table and surrounded by florals, the wedding cake also included tall, interactive candles that the couple blew out.

Dante’s reception dress was a marriage of upscale cocktail dress and floor-length formalwear. The strapless gown featured a foldover neckline and a structured bodice that ended mid-thigh, cascading into a sheer lace skirt. Vintage lace gloves and strappy satin heels tied the look together, and the look was accessorized with a monobotanical purse bouquet of lilies wrapped in a satin ribbon and pearls.
